Last chance to enter Harrogate's Christmas shop window competition Entries are set to close for the annual Harrogate Christmas shop window competition. Organised by Harrogate BID, the competition is in its fourth year and aims to promote town centre shopping, whilst also broadcasting the ‘shop local’ message in the run up to Christmas. Last year the overall winner of the competition was Weetons. And this year, judges are looking for illumination, innovation and ‘spirit of Christmas.’ [caption id="attachment_87980" align="alignnone" width="1024"] The Yorkshire Soap Company in Harrogate. (Photo: Calvin Singleton)[/caption] Entries must be submitted by Friday 24th November, with judging taking place on Thursday 30th November. An awards ceremony will then take place on 7th December to name the winners. The competition has three categories: large retailer, medium retailer and small retailer.
